It's something everyone dreams of': Jackson Blake, Bradly Nadeau on NHL  Debuts - Carolina Hurricanes News, Analysis and More

The Carolina Hurricanes will be making a few more dreams come true tonight as both Jackson Blake and Bradly Nadeau will be making their NHL debuts.

With the Canes already locked into their playoff position, the team elected to sit some starters, so the chance for the rookies to come in became evident.

Here's what they along with their head coach Rod Brind'Amour had to say about the opportunity:

Rod Brind'Amour

On what he hopes to see from the debuts: I hope it's a good experience. I hope they play well, obviously, and have a great memory. That's really what it's about for this game for them. First game, you want to have something special happen. It'd be great."

On being able to see the young talent: We're excited about these players. The future is bright when you have good, young talent. Not that we don't have old, good talent, we have a good group obviously, but it's nice to see that these kids are coming.

Jackson Blake

On his emotions: It's exciting for sure. Obviously you dream of playing your first game in the NHL as a kid and for it to become reality tonight is super emotional for me and my family and I can't wait.

On who will be in attendance: Two of my siblings will be here, my younger sister and younger brother, and then both my parents will be here. So it will be a pretty special night for not only me, but them as well.

On any advice he's received from his father: I haven't talked to him yet. I kind of just found out before morning skate. I'm sure I'll call him before the game and he'll give me his two cents on everything. We'll see what he says.

On having other rookies also making debuts alongside him: It's been a huge help to have Scottie [Morrow] and Bradly [Nadeau] here. Obviously we're all pretty much in the same boat, playing college and then coming here. We've been sticking together these last couple of weeks we've been together and it's made it easier on me to know that I'm not the only guy going through the things that I've gone through. It's been super awesome to have both those guys here.

Bradly Nadeau

On his emotions: I think it's going to be a big night tonight. It's something everyone dreams of and hopefully I'll get the most of it and just have fun and hopefully help the team get a win here.

On how helpful having fellow rookies on the team has been: It helps a lot and makes it easier. You know you're not the only one going through it and also we're living together so it makes it a lot easier and he's making his debut too so that should be exciting doing it together.

On the messages from the coaching staff: They told me to shoot the puck. Just go out there and have fun and see how it goes. So that's what I'll do and I'll see how it turns out.

On if he'll have anyone in attendance: I don't think so. I think when I told them it was a bit too late for them to make the trip. But they'll be watching and it will be fun.
